Sebelius pushes for Congress to pass a bailout package, help states

Gov. Kathleen Sebelius is lobbying Kansas’ congressional delegation for a new stimulus package to help states deal with their financial problems.

Legislative researchers project that Kansas will end its 2009 fiscal year on June 30 with a $141 million budget deficit, and they say if the state’s problems aren’t addressed, the shortfall would grow to $1.02 billion by the end of fiscal 2010.

Sebelius, a Democrat, wrote the state’s Republican-dominated congressional delegation Friday. She said Congress should pass a new stimulus package with additional Medicaid and highway funds. The outgoing Congress could debate a package during a lame-duck session that begins next week.
